How much do mobile app developer jobs pay per year?

As of Aug 5, 2026, the average yearly pay for mobile app developer in the United States is $110,482.00,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$83,500.00 and $127,500.00 per year,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What are some common challenges mobile app developers face when working on cross-platform applications?

Mobile App Developers often encounter challenges when developing cross-platform applications, such as ensuring consistent user experiences across different devices and operating systems. Managing varying hardware capabilities, screen sizes, and OS-specific behaviors can require extra testing and fine-tuning. Additionally, integrating with native features or third-party services may demand creative problem-solving to maintain performance and functionality. Collaboration with designers and QA teams is essential to address these challenges and deliver high-quality apps.

What is a mobile app developer?

Mobile app developers are professionals who design, build, and maintain applications for mobile devices such as smartphones and tablets. They use programming languages like Java, Swift, or Kotlin to create apps for platforms such as iOS and Android. These developers work closely with designers and other team members to ensure the app is user-friendly, functional, and meets client or business requirements. Their responsibilities also include testing and updating apps to fix bugs and add new features.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a mobile app developer, and why are they important?

To thrive as a Mobile App Developer, you need strong programming skills in languages such as Java, Kotlin, Swift, or Flutter, supported by a relevant degree or equivalent experience. Familiarity with development environments like Android Studio or Xcode, along with knowledge of APIs and app deployment processes, is typically required. Creativity, problem-solving, and effective communication help developers interpret user needs and collaborate with designers or stakeholders. These competencies ensure the creation of high-quality, user-friendly apps that meet business objectives and industry standards.
